:OUTPut<hw>:PROTection:TRIPped?
The command queries the state of the protective circuit.
Return values:
0|1|OFF|ON<Tripped>
OUTP:PROT:TRIP
Queries the state of the protective circuit for RF output A.
Response: 0
The protective circuit has not tripped.
Response: 1
The protective circuit has tripped.

:OUTPut<hw>[:STATe]:PON <Pon>
This command selects the state which the RF output assumes when the instrument is
switched on.
Parameters:
OFF|UNCHanged
OFF
The output is deactivated when the instrument is switched on.
UNCHanged
When the instrument is switched on, the output remains in the
same state as it was when the instrument was switched off.
